Original Description
Fritz Syberg’s A Girl With Her Needlework (1907) captures a quiet, introspective moment, bathed in the soft light of a Scandinavian interior. The painting reflects the artist’s connection to the Funen School, a Danish movement emphasizing intimate, earthy depictions of rural life. Syberg’s loose brushwork and muted palette—dominated by warm browns, creams, and subtle blues—create a sense of tranquility, while the young girl’s absorbed posture bridges realism and emotional depth. Historically, this work exemplifies early 20th-century Danish modernism, where everyday scenes gained lyrical weight. Unlike the grand narratives of academic art, Syberg’s focus on domestic simplicity marked a turning point, making it a subtle yet significant piece in Nordic art history. The painting’s quiet elegance and restrained emotion continue to resonate, offering a timeless glimpse into the beauty of ordinary life.
